数学模型——饮料的加工和维修_第1页
数学模型——饮料的加工和维修_第2页
数学模型——饮料的加工和维修_第3页
数学模型——饮料的加工和维修_第4页
数学模型——饮料的加工和维修_第5页
已阅读5页,还剩12页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、第四章第四章 数学规划模型数学规划模型 饮料厂的生产与检修饮料厂的生产与检修 小组成员:小组成员: 企业生产计划企业生产计划单阶段生产计划单阶段生产计划多阶段生产计划多阶段生产计划外部需求外部需求和内部资和内部资源随时间源随时间变化变化生产批量问题生产批量问题考虑与产量无关的固定费用,考虑与产量无关的固定费用,并给优化模型求解带来新的并给优化模型求解带来新的困难困难例1 饮料厂的生产与检修计划某种饮料某种饮料4 4周的需求量、生产能力和成本周的需求量、生产能力和成本周次周次需求量需求量(千箱千箱)生产能力生产能力(千箱千箱)成本成本(千元千元/千箱千箱)115305.0225405.13354

2、55.4425205.5合计合计100135存贮费存贮费: :每周每千箱饮料每周每千箱饮料 0.2千元。千元。 安排生产计划安排生产计划,满足每周的需求满足每周的需求,使使4周周总费用最小。总费用最小。 在在4周内安排一次设备检修,占用当周周内安排一次设备检修,占用当周15千箱生产能力,能使千箱生产能力,能使 检修后每周增产检修后每周增产5千箱,检修应排在哪一周千箱,检修应排在哪一周? ?问题分析问题分析周次周次需求需求能力能力11530225403354542520合计合计100135成本成本5.0除第除第4周外每周的生产能周外每周的生产能力超过每周的需求;力超过每周的需求

3、;生产成本逐周上升;生产成本逐周上升;前几周应多生产一些前几周应多生产一些模型假设模型假设 饮料厂在第饮料厂在第1周开始时没有库存;周开始时没有库存; 从费用最小考虑从费用最小考虑, , 第第4周末不能有库存;周末不能有库存; 周末有库存时需支出一周的存贮费;周末有库存时需支出一周的存贮费; 每周末的库存量等于下周初的库存量每周末的库存量等于下周初的库存量。 模型建立模型建立周次周次需求需求能力能力11530225403354542520成本成本5.0决策变量决策变量x1x4:第:第14周周的生产量的生产量 y1y3:第:第13周末周末库存量库存量存贮费存贮费: :0.2(

4、(千元千元/ /周周千箱千箱) ) 目标目标函数函数)( 2 . 05 . 54 . 51 . 50 . 53214321yyyxxxxzMin产量、库存与需求平衡产量、库存与需求平衡能力限制能力限制1511 yx25212yyx35323yyx2534 yx20,4540,304321xxxx非负限制非负限制0,3214321yyyxxxx模型求解模型求解LINGO求解求解最优解:最优解: x1 x4:15,40,25,20; y1 y3: 0,15,5 .LINGO是用于求解非线性规划,也可以用于一些线性和非线性方程组的求解的软件周次周次需求需求能力能力115302254033545425

5、20成本成本5.0产量产量15402520库存库存01550由表格的数据可以计算得到:由表格的数据可以计算得到:4周生产计划的总费用为周生产计划的总费用为528 (千元千元) 检修计划检修计划 在在4周内安排一次设备检修,占用当周周内安排一次设备检修,占用当周15千箱生产能力,能千箱生产能力,能使检修后每周增产使检修后每周增产5千箱,检修应排在哪一周千箱,检修应排在哪一周? ? 周次周次需求需求能力能力11530225403354542520成本成本5.0从题目看从题目看检修安排在任一周均可检修安排在任一周均可我们引用我们引用0-1变量变量wt :wt=1=

6、1 检修安排在第检修安排在第t周周(t=1,2,3,4)约束约束条件条件产量、库存与产量、库存与需求平衡条件需求平衡条件不变不变能力限制能力限制204540304321xxxx301511wx12254015wwx1233554515wwwx321445552015wwwwx由于四周只有一次检修,由于四周只有一次检修,则应多加一条约束条件则应多加一条约束条件14321wwwww1,w2,w3,w4 0,1LINGO求解求解输入形式:输入形式:min=5.0*x1+5.1*x2+5.4*x3+5.5*x4+0.2*(y1+y2+y3);x1-y1=15;x2+y1-y2=25;x3+y2-y3=

7、35;x4+y3=25;x1+15*w1=30;x2+15*w2-5*w1=40;x3+15*w3-5*w2-5*w1=45;x4+15*w4-5*(w1+w2+w3)=0;x2=0;x3=0;x4=0;y1=0;y2=0;y3=0;bin(w1);bin(w2);bin(w3);bin(w4); 运行结果: Global optimal solution found . Objective value: 527.0000 Extended solver steps: 0 Total solver iterations: 5 Variable Value Reduced Cost X1 15.

8、00000 0.000000 X2 45.00000 0.000000 X3 15.00000 0.000000 X4 25.00000 0.000000 Y1 0.000000 0.000000 Y2 20.00000 0.000000 Y3 0.000000 0.1000000 W1 1.000000 -0.5000000 W2 0.000000 1.500000 W3 0.000000 0.000000 W4 0.000000 0.000000 最优解:最优解: w1= =1, w2 , w3, w4=0; x1 x4:15, ,45, ,15, ,25; y1 y3:0, ,20, ,

9、0 .经过计算:经过计算:总费用由总费用由528千元降千元降为为527千元千元 通过上面的分析,可以发现:检通过上面的分析,可以发现:检修所导致的生产能力提高的作用修所导致的生产能力提高的作用, 需要需要更长的时间才能得到充分体现。更长的时间才能得到充分体现。 例例2饮料的生产批量问题饮料的生产批量问题 饮料厂使用同一条生产线轮流生产饮料厂使用同一条生产线轮流生产多种多种饮料。若某饮料。若某周开工生产周开工生产某种某种饮料饮料, 需支出需支出生产准备费生产准备费8千元千元。某种饮料某种饮料4周的需求量、生产能力和成本周的需求量、生产能力和成本周次周次需求量需求量(千箱千箱)生产能力生产能力(千

10、箱千箱)成本成本(千元千元/千箱千箱)115305.0225405.1335455.4425205.5合计合计100135 存贮费存贮费: :每周每千箱饮料每周每千箱饮料 0.2千元。千元。 问题问题 安排生产计划安排生产计划, 满足每周的需求满足每周的需求, 使使4周总费用最周总费用最小小。注意:这里注意:这里的生产准备的生产准备费是每周结费是每周结算的,就是算的,就是开工几周就开工几周就交几周的费交几周的费用,而非开用,而非开始交一份就始交一份就可以可以问题分析问题分析:这一问题与例一的差别在于:除了考虑随产这一问题与例一的差别在于:除了考虑随产品数量变化的费用(如生产成本和存贮费),还要

11、考虑与产品数量变化的费用(如生产成本和存贮费),还要考虑与产品数量无关的费用,即生产准备费,只要某周开工生产时就品数量无关的费用,即生产准备费,只要某周开工生产时就有这项费用。有这项费用。模型的建立与求解:模型的建立与求解:生产批量问题的一般提法生产批量问题的一般提法ct 时段时段t 单件产品单件产品生产成本生产成本( (元元/ /件件) );ht 时段时段t 单件产品一个时段单件产品一个时段( (末末) )库存库存费费( (元元/ /件件) );st 时段时段t 需付需付生产准备费生产准备费( (元元) );dt 时段时段t 市场需求市场需求( (件件) );Mt 时段时段t 生产能力生产能

12、力( (件件) )。假设初始库存为假设初始库存为0 制订生产计划制订生产计划, , 满足需求满足需求, ,并使并使T个时段的总费用最小。个时段的总费用最小。在本例中为四个时段,在本例中为四个时段,一周是一个时段一周是一个时段决策变量决策变量 x t 时段时段t 生产量;生产量;y t 时段时段t ( (末末) )库存量;库存量;wt =1 时段时段t 开工开工生产生产 ( (wt =0 不开工不开工) )。为了表述在为了表述在t时段时段是否生产这种饮是否生产这种饮料,从而确定是料,从而确定是否要支付生产准否要支付生产准备费,引用了备费,引用了0-1变量变量wt , wt =1=1表表示生产,示

13、生产, wt =0=0表表示不生产。示不生产。目标目标)( min1tttttTttyhxcwsz约束条件约束条件ttttdyxy1tttttMxxxw, 0, 0, 0, 10, 00ttTyxyy生产批量问题的一般提法生产批量问题的一般提法)( min1tttttTttyhxcwszttttdyxyts1. .tttttMxxxw, 0, 0, 0, 10tttwMxTtyxyyttT, 2 , 10, 00混合混合0-1规划模型规划模型( (同时同时包含连续变量和整数变包含连续变量和整数变量的数学规划)量的数学规划) 将所给参数代入模型,用将所给参数代入模型,用LINGO求解求解Sets:periods/1.4/:s,c,h,d,m,x,y,w;endsetsdata:s=8888;c=5.0;h=0.2;d=15253525;m=30404520;enddatamin=asum(periods:s*w+c*x+h*y);x(1)d(1)=y(1);afor(periods(t)it#gt#1:y(t-1)+x(

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论